5-Day City Experiences in Salzburg

Thursday, October 5: Explore Historic Salzburg

Start your trip by immersing yourself in the rich history of Salzburg. In the morning, visit the iconic Salzburg Cathedral, a magnificent Baroque church dating back to the 17th century. Then, take a leisurely stroll through the charming Getreidegasse, known for its narrow lanes and traditional shops. In the afternoon, explore Hohensalzburg Fortress, one of the largest medieval castles in Europe, offering panoramic views of the city. As the evening sets in, head to the Mozartplatz and enjoy a classical music performance at the Mozarteum.

  • Salzburg Cathedral: Entrance fee - €5, Time spent - 1 hour
  • Getreidegasse: Free,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Hohensalzburg Fortress: Entrance fee - €15, Time spent - 3 hours
  • Mozartplatz: Free, Time spent - Evening
Restaurants
  • For breakfast, head to Café Tomaselli, an iconic café dating back to 1703. Indulge in their delicious pastries and aromatic coffee. Average cost for a meal is about €10 per person.
  • For lunch, try St. Peter Stiftskulinarium, located in the oldest restaurant in Central Europe. Enjoy Austrian specialties in a historic setting. Average cost for a meal is about €20 per person.
  • For dinner, visit Gasthof Goldgasse, a cozy restaurant known for its traditional Austrian cuisine. Try their schnitzel or goulash paired with local wine. Average cost for a meal is about €30 per person.
Friday, October 6: Art and Music in Salzburg

Start your day by visiting the Museum der Moderne Salzburg, located on the Mönchsberg mountain. Explore its impressive collection of contemporary art and enjoy breathtaking views of the city. In the afternoon, head to the Salzburg Museum, showcasing the history and culture of the region. Afterward, take a walk along the Salzach River and cross the Makartsteg Bridge adorned with love locks. In the evening, attend a classical music concert at the magnificent Mirabell Palace.

  • Museum der Moderne Salzburg: Entrance fee - €8,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Salzburg Museum: Entrance fee - €9,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Makartsteg Bridge: Free, Time spent - 1 hour
  • Mirabell Palace: Concert ticket - €30, Time spent - Evening
Saturday, October 7: Day Trip to Berchtesgaden

Embark on a day trip to the picturesque town of Berchtesgaden, located just a short drive from Salzburg. In the morning, explore the stunning Berchtesgaden National Park, known for its pristine lakes and majestic mountains. Take a boat ride on Lake Königssee and marvel at the crystal-clear waters surrounded by towering peaks. In the afternoon, visit the historic Eagle's Nest, Hitler's former mountain retreat, offering breathtaking views. Return to Salzburg in the evening and enjoy a traditional Austrian dinner at a local restaurant.

  • Berchtesgaden National Park: Entrance fee - €5, Boat ride - €15, Time spent - 4 hours
  • Eagle's Nest: Entrance fee - €16,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Traditional Dinner: Cost - €30 per person, Time spent - Evening
Restaurants
  • Start your day with a delicious breakfast at Café Fingerlos, known for its freshly baked pastries and great coffee. Average cost for a meal is about €10 per person.
  • For lunch, head to Alpenhof St. George, a cozy restaurant serving traditional Austrian dishes, including hearty soups and schnitzel. Average cost for a meal is about €15 per person.
  • In the evening, indulge in a fine dining experience at Restaurant Esszimmer, offering a creative menu featuring innovative dishes made with locally sourced ingredients. Average cost for a meal is about €40 per person.
Sunday, October 8: Sound of Music Tour

Embark on a Sound of Music Tour to explore the iconic filming locations of this beloved musical. In the morning, visit the Mirabell Gardens, where the "Do-Re-Mi" scene was filmed. Then, travel to Leopoldskron Palace, the setting for the Von Trapp family home. In the afternoon, visit the picturesque village of Mondsee and see the famous Mondsee Abbey, where the wedding scene was filmed. Return to Salzburg and spend the evening enjoying a delightful dinner at a traditional Austrian tavern.

  • Mirabell Gardens: Free, Time spent - 1 hour
  • Leopoldskron Palace: Exterior visit, Free, Time spent - 1 hour
  • Mondsee Abbey: Entrance fee - €3,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Traditional Dinner: Cost - €30 per person, Time spent - Evening
Monday, October 9: Explore Hellbrunn Palace and Gardens

Spend your final day exploring the enchanting Hellbrunn Palace and Gardens. In the morning, visit the palace and marvel at its unique trick fountains, designed to surprise and entertain visitors. Take a leisurely stroll through the beautifully manicured gardens and enjoy the peaceful atmosphere. In the afternoon, explore the nearby Zoo Salzburg, home to a wide variety of animal species. End your trip with a delightful dinner at a rooftop restaurant, overlooking the city.

  • Hellbrunn Palace: Entrance fee - €12,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Hellbrunn Gardens: Free, Time spent - 1 hour
  • Zoo Salzburg: Entrance fee - €10, Time spent - 3 hours
  • Rooftop Dinner: Cost - €40 per person, Time spent - Evening

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For a unique experience, explore the charming neighborhood of Linzergasse, known for its quaint shops and cozy cafes. Take a walk along the Salzach River promenade, where you can admire the beautiful architecture and enjoy stunning views of the city. Visit the Salzburg Marionette Theater for a delightful puppet show, showcasing the city's rich cultural heritage. Don't miss the opportunity to try traditional Austrian pastries, such as Sachertorte and Apfelstrudel, at Café Fürst or Café Tomaselli.
